If not properly tended to, the slow build-up of newspapers, magazines, bills and junk mail can overrun your home like a pervasive weed in a flowerbed. Here are a few tips for clearing the paper clutter--and keeping it organized for good:

Organize

Sort through stacks of paper and separate according to category: bills, reading material and junk mail.

Designate

Go through the pile of junk mail, and separate the "safe" from the "sensitive." Sensitive trash includes anything containing your name, address, phone number or any other personal information; shred these before recycling. Tip: Most cities now have either drop-off locations or pick-up services for recycling paper.
